The 'Israel Museum' (, ''Muzion Yisrael'') in Jerusalem, was founded in 1965 as Israel's national museum.
The museum comprises of several main sections:

★ The collection of the Bezalel Museum of Fine Arts;

★ a vast collection of Judaica and Ethnography, exhibits of items typical of various Diaspora Jewish communities;

★ Fine art galleries;

★ Period rooms;

★ Art objects from Africa, North and South America, Oceania and the Far East;

★ An archeological wing containing artifacts from prehistoric times to the 15th century;

★ A sculpture garden with over 60 works;

★ The Shrine of the Book which houses rare biblical manuscripts, including the Dead Sea Scrolls;

★ A youth wing comprising galleries, classrooms and workshops, with an extensive educational program;
